Jack is standing on the roof of his house in kicked a rubber ball in the air for it to land on the ground for his dog Henry to fetch.The ball is launched into the air from a height of 12 feet at time t=0. The function that models the situation is h(f) = -2t^2 + 10t +12, where T is measured in seconds and H is the height in feet

When will the ball hit the ground?

it will hit the ground when the height is zero, right? So just solve
-2t^2 + 10t +12 = 0
in the usual way that can be rewritten as
t^2 - 5t - 6 = 0
which should be easy to factor and solve.
